Image Tags
Circuit de Barcelona-Catalunya Catalan Grand Prix Formula One race track sunset Barcelona Catalonia Spain Europe motorsports racing speed performance adrenaline excitement sports competition victory podium drivers teams fans spectators atmosphere energy passion exhilaration thrill adventure experience Circuit de Barcelona-Catalunya Catalan Grand Prix Formula One race track sunset Barcelona Catalonia Spain Europe motorsports racing speed performance adrenaline excitement sports
Circuit de Barcelona-Catalunya bathed in the warm hues of the setting sun
Size 1920 × 3840
Format jpg
Free Download